Israel expands military operations in southern Lebanon

The Israeli army widened its operations in southern Lebanon through air strikes, artillery bombardment and ground incursions, targeting areas from Ali al-Tahir to Kafr Shouba.

Operations extended throughout the day across several sectors, combining air strikes, artillery fire, ground incursions, demolition and sweeping operations, targeting Ali al-Tahir, Nabatiyeh al-Fouqa, Iqlim al-Tuffah, Marjayoun, al-Mansouri, Haresh and Kafr Shouba.

The Israeli army said it launched the strikes in response to Hezbollah firing two explosive drones at its forces in Ali al-Tahir, adding that it targeted Hezbollah infrastructure in Nabatiyeh. Hezbollah issued no statement confirming the army's account of the drone launches.

An air strike on Arbasalieh killed citizen Saja Moussa Shararah and wounded others after a warplane targeted her family home in the town and destroyed it. Shararah had been married just 48 hours earlier.

Heavy bombardment began around 6 a.m. on Ali al-Tahir with concussive missiles that caused large explosions followed by thick smoke. This was preceded overnight by strikes on the area between Zoutar al-Sharqiyeh and Meifoun.

Israeli aircraft struck several buildings in al-Mansouri in Tyre district at dawn, with explosion blasts heard in Tyre city and surrounding villages, breaking windows in adjacent areas.

An Israeli force accompanied by tanks and bulldozers advanced into the western outskirts of Marjayoun in the Dabash area, burning homes and uprooting agricultural greenhouses, and used a truck loaded with explosives to carry out a demolition operation in the neighbourhood.

Israeli forces conducted a broad sweep towards the edges of Haresh from the direction of Hadatha, with gunfire hitting homes in the area. Operations extended to Kafr Shouba where two Merkava tanks and military vehicles advanced into the eastern outskirts of the town in the Shammis area.

The Israeli forces raised their flag in the Shammis area of Kafr Shouba during the incursion, concurrent with intensive sweeping operations using machine gun fire in its vicinity.
